Staying healthy
is a vital component of the overall success of students at Northland International
University. The Northland Health Center, staffed by a registered nurse, is
open Monday through Friday from 9:00 a.m. to 4:00 p.m. The
Health Center provides students with preventative care and wellness promotion,
assessment and treatment of minor illnesses and injuries, and physician
referral. Appointments at the Health Center are not required but are
recommended. Serious illnesses or injuries and other health needs that occur
after normal business hours are referred to an off-campus medical facility in
Iron Mountain, Michigan—Dickinson County Healthcare System.
